WebFeb 4, 2024 · However, CFIUS can review transactions within its jurisdiction without receiving a filing. Therefore, real estate investors should be aware of two threshold rules that frame CFIUS' jurisdiction. 1. Who Is a Foreign Person? This is a threshold question in any CFIUS analysis because CFIUS covers only investments by foreign persons. WebMar 22, 2024 · CFIUS is a U.S. government interagency committee charged with (1) reviewing foreign acquisitions of, or investments in, U.S. businesses and (2) identifying and mitigating any risks to national security raised by those transactions.
